    Joshua H.

    Based only on this one take out/deliver meal experience I have to say, this place is good! The items I got were solid other than the tom yum ta lay soup. It was a bit too sour for me and the bay leaves you cannot eat, its only for flavoring the broth. Some other unique veggie in the soup does not make well for chewing and needs be removed when eating it I suggest, its like tree bark almost. Not a bad soup, just had some odd ingredients. The rest was solid! The pad that with pork level 3 heat, amazing! Huge portion also. The yellow curry is on fire! Not for spicy heat but flavor! I got chicken in mine and it worked very well. The curry broth is rich, thick, aromatic and purely delicious. I used SA2Go for delivery and it took maybe 25 minutes from app order to doorstep arrival. I had rice and leftovers for the next day as well.

    Nancy M.

    I lived in Indonesia for two years in the 1980s and love sate and good peanut sauce. I moved from San Antonio to San Angelo and surprise surprise by Ban Moon has good Sate and great peanut sauce. Could not find this food at all in San Antonio It must be Laotian because it doesn't taste like any Thai peanut sauce I've ever had, and to be honest with you I don't like Thai peanut sauce. So happy to have retired to a place where I can eat this whenever I want.!
